Santa Anita Cancels Racing Jan. 3 Due to Expected Rain

About an inch of rain is forecast through the weekend.

Santa Anita Park canceled racing Jan. 3 due to anticipated heavy rain. A decision for Jan. 4 racing program will be made early Sunday morning to evaluate the most up-to-date forecast.

Precipitation is also expected Sunday, but to a lesser degree than Saturday. About an inch of rain is forecast for Arcadia, Calif, where Santa Anita is located.

California tracks operate under a strict inclement-weather policy that often results in cancellations during wet conditions.

A makeup racing day will be added Thursday, Jan. 15. This is in addition to the previously announced addition of live racing on Thursday, Jan. 8 to the schedule.

This marks the latest in a string of cancellations for Santa Anita, which was forced to delay its customary Dec. 26 opening day until Dec. 28. A crowd of 41,962 attended the rescheduled opening day, the largest crowd in nine years and the most for a Sunday opener since 1999.

Winter is the rainy season in customarily dry Southern California, but the past two weeks in the region have been uncharacteristically wet.
